The upcoming Dragon Ball theme park promises a truly immersive experience. Spanning a massive 500,000 square meters, the park will be divided into seven distinct zones, each inspired by one of the legendary Dragon Balls. Get ready to explore iconic locations like Kame House, the training grounds where Goku honed his skills under Master Roshi, and the futuristic Capsule Corporation headquarters.

The park boasts a staggering 30 rides, catering to all levels of thrill-seekers. Imagine yourself soaring through the skies on a high-speed rollercoaster shaped like Shenron, the magnificent dragon, or testing your reflexes in a battle simulator experience. Five groundbreaking attractions will further immerse you in the Dragon Ball universe, leaving you breathless with excitement.
The experience goes beyond rides and attractions. The Dragon Ball theme park will offer in-park hotels designed to transport you further into the world of Dragon Ball. Foodies rejoice! Themed restaurants will serve delicious dishes inspired by the anime, allowing you to fuel up like your favorite Saiyan warrior before your next adventure.
